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F) with both the top and bottom heat elements on.
In a mixing bowl, mash 3 ripe bananas (about 1 1/3 cups mashed), and mix them with 1 tablespoon neutral oil, 6 tablespoons applesauce, 100 ml sugar-free vanilla soy milk, and 1 tsp vanilla extract until well combined. Use a potato masher or fork for this step, being careful not to over-mash to avoid a dense texture.
Add the dry ingredients to the bowl: 225 g (about 1 3/4 cups) of flour, 190 g of stevia sugar substitute (equivalent to 1 cup of regular sugar), 2 tsp baking powder, ¼ tsp salt, and 1 tbsp cornstarch. Stir the batter until all the ingredients are fully incorporated.
Pour the batter into a loaf pan, ensuring it's evenly distributed. A loaf pan approximately 23-25 cm long works well for this recipe. If you're choosing to add nuts or chocolate chips, add them in and stir with a spoon to incorporate them into the batter.
Place the pan in the preheated oven and bake at 180°C (350°F) for about 60 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Once baked, remove the banana bread from the oven and let it cool in the pan for a few minutes before transferring it to a wire rack to cool completely. Enjoy your WW banana bread!
